Description

The Labour Market Information for All service was transferred to DfE from the UK Commission for Employment and Skills (UKCES) in October 2016.
LMI for all is a collation of high quality datasets. The service runs on the principles of open data, which means the data can be accessed free of charge via an API (application programming interface). Third party developers can access the data to create careers applications, which can be embedded into careers websites. The data is then used by a wide range of stakeholders, such as schools, career practitioners, adults and young people.
The key benefit of LMI for All is that it provides robust data from national sources that allow end-users to explore and compare occupations they are interested in on a consistent basis.
The project aims for LMI for all are:
• To maintain and develop a comprehensive, high quality data offering that can inform career choices.
• To offer a technical infrastructure that provides a secure, engaging, accessible and reliable platform for LMI for All.
• To promote the widest possible take-up among third-party websites and applications as a means of opening-up the data to individual decision-makers
• To build wider awareness, understanding and support for LMI for All among key stakeholder groups, including careers and technical communities.
The service compromises three main parts. A technical infrastructure which involves ensuring the service is secure, non disclosive and accessible. Data housing and data development which involves refreshing the data and maintaining the quality of the data. Stakeholder engagement which involves promoting awareness and understanding of LMI for All.
